Andreas Bauer is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Andreas Bauer has authored 50 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Electrical and Electronic Engineering, 18 papers in Materials Chemistry and 13 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Andreas Bauer’s work include Chalcogenide Semiconductor Thin Films (13 papers), Quantum Dots Synthesis And Properties (11 papers) and Copper-based nanomaterials and applications (8 papers). Andreas Bauer is often cited by papers focused on Chalcogenide Semiconductor Thin Films (13 papers), Quantum Dots Synthesis And Properties (11 papers) and Copper-based nanomaterials and applications (8 papers). Andreas Bauer collaborates with scholars based in Germany, United States and Switzerland. Andreas Bauer's co-authors include Michael Powalla, Theresa Magorian Friedlmeier, Dimitrios Hariskos, Roland Wüerz, Philip Jackson, Oliver Kiowski, G. Kaindl, Erik Ahlswede, R. Ludeke and Jonas Hanisch and has published in prestigious journals such as Physical Review Letters, Applied Physics Letters and Journal of Applied Physics.
